Community Health Plan of Imperial Valley (CHPIV) is a locally managed public health care plan operating under the Medi-Cal Managed Care Program. Providing services primarily to members, providers, and residents of Imperial County, CHPIV focuses on reducing healthcare costs while maintaining high-quality care through managed care features like provider networks and wellness programs. The organization collaborates with Health Net to ensure a robust network of healthcare providers, aiming to deliver exceptional healthcare to its members.

β’ Oversees regulatory compliance activities including regulatory audits and regulatory reports β’ Supervise the Compliance Advisor and provide mentorship and guidance. β’ Develop and deliver comprehensive compliance training programs for employees, management, and relevant stakeholders, promoting a culture of compliance awareness and ethical conduct throughout the organization. β’ Work closely with the Senior Director of Compliance to develop strategies for effectively managing the Regulatory Compliance team. β’ Provide strategic guidance to internal business units and delegates to identify gaps, develop and implement corrective action plans and facilitate monitoring activities to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. β’ Develop, maintain, and monitor Compliance & Policy Committee (CPC) Charter, Compliance Program and key performance indicators. β’ Responsible for the development of Board/committee write-ups to be presented at Compliance Committees and other committees as needed. β’ Take a leading role in managing external state and federal regulatory audits, ensuring compliance and addressing any issues that arise. β’ Develop and implement comprehensive regulatory audit readiness programs, such as conducting mock audits to proactively identify and address potential compliance gaps. β’ Coordinate audit preparation activities, facilitate audit responses, and ensure that all regulatory requirements are met. β’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of the Compliance Program, making improvements as necessary to ensure optimal performance and regulatory adherence. β’ Prepare and present regular reports on compliance activities, risks, and outcomes to the senior leadership team, providing insights and recommendations for continuous improvement. β’ Liaise with external regulatory bodies and industry groups to stay current with compliance trends, changes in legislation, and best practices, and integrate this knowledge into the organization's compliance framework. β’ Lead the development and implementation of risk assessment methodologies to identify, analyze, and mitigate potential compliance risks.
β’ Bachelorβs degree in public health or health care management from an accredited college or university; or equivalent education/experience in related area. β’ 5+ years of experience working in the compliance function in a Medi-Cal managed care setting β’ Knowledge of Medi-Cal Managed Care principles β’ Working knowledge of DHCS and Knox-Keene requirements, as well as highly developed analytical and critical thinking skills, to serve as a resource to internal business units and delegates.
